Product Details of [ 36809-08-2 ]

CAS No. :36809-08-2
Formula : C13H9ClO3
M.W : 248.66
SMILES Code : O=C(O)C1=CC=CC=C1OC2=CC=CC=C2Cl
English Name :2-(2-Chlorophenoxy)benzoic acid
MDL No. :MFCD06260646

YieldReaction ConditionsOperation in experiment
With 1-methyl-1H-imidazole; N,N,N',N'-tetramethylchloroformamidinium hexafluorophosphate In dichloromethane at 20 - 40℃; 11 General procedure: At room temperature, into a 10 mL pressure-resistant tube, add 1 mmol of intermediate pyrazolamide II-a, 1.1mmol 2-phenoxybenzoic acid, 3mL anhydrous dichloromethane, 3.5mmol N-methylimidazole and 1.2mmol tetramethylchloroformamidinium hexafluorophosphate, then stir for 10 minutes, raise the temperature of the reaction system to 40°C and react for 4 hours. TLC traces the reaction. After the reaction is completed, after extraction, drying, concentration, and column passing, a yellow solid, compound I-1, was obtained with a yield of 51.5%;
